There are even types of fiber to help reduce the risk of colon cancer. The fiber is a complex carbohydrate that is not digested. It cannot also be absorbed into our blood. The fiber in our meal comes from plants. There are two different types, insoluble and soluble fiber. A soluble fiber is a type that is expected to reduce cholesterol. The soluble fiber can be obtained by consuming oatmeal, barley, citrus fruits and dried beans. Having a high fiber content that contains soluble fiber to help weight loss. This is because after eating food containing this type of fiber you will be left fully for a long time. This is more often known as RubhaGe. The advantage of including roughening in a high fiber diet is that it helps to prevent colon cancer. Insoluble fiber has also shown great advantages in preventing diverticulosis prevention.
Recent medical studies have shown that a high fiber diet can also be particularly advantageous for suffering diabetes. Diabetics, which include at least 50 grams of fiber in their diet, have reduced glucose levels by at least 10%. Diabetics who have added so much fiber have also shown a significant reduction in insulin levels in their blood.
High fiber diet has also been proven to be beneficial for suffering heartburn. One in five Americans suffers from heartburn and sometimes can lead to ulcers and in extreme cases of esophageal cancer. Health experts now recommend high fiber and low -fat diet that helps prevent heartburn.
Although a high fiber dietAnd it can help prevent many complaints, such as irritable colon syndrome, too much fiber is as bad as too little. It is recommended that you stay 20 to 35 grams a day. The inclusion of too much fibers in your diet can lead to diarrhea and flatulence. Holding the recommended amount should help stop these problems.
